2017-02-06 11 views
-2

を私が反応-ネイティブアプリケーションとの問題、すなわちを持っている:開発サーバーが応答エラーコードを返しました:401リアクトネイティブのAndroid問題を:開発サーバーが応答エラーコードが返さ:401

Android emulator error with React-native App

+0

あなたは私たちにあなたが送信しようとしている要求を表示することができますか?何らかの認証が必要なようです。たとえば、サーバーにキーまたはユーザー名/パスワードが必要ですか? –

+0

また、この質問は十分な有用な情報を提供していません。内部の '10.x.x.x 'の範囲にあるので、サーバに問い合わせることはできません。また、動作するソースコードはありません。 [最小で完全で検証可能な例]を提供してください(http://stackoverflow.com/help/mcve)。 –

+0

私のサーバーにはユーザー名やパスワードは必要ありません。私はコマンドプロンプト、つまり「反応ネイティブスタート」でサーバーを起動し、「反応ネイティブランアンドロイド」でアンドロイドアプリを実行します – Faisal

答えて

0

あなたは実行する必要がありますサーバー:

$ react-native run-android (launches the app on the emulator) 
$ react-native start  (loads the server) 

これが機能しない場合は、そのポートでサービスを実行していないことを確認してください。

また、この指示に従ってポートを変更することができます

React Native "Could not connect to development server."

+0

はい、両方とも実行しても、このエラーが発生しています。また、デフォルトのポート8081がビジー状態だったため、「react-native start --port = 8088」というコマンドを実行しました。私はサーバーを実行してアンドロイドが走っている。これは、私が思うようなネイティブの問題です。 – Faisal

+0

起動用にポートを変更する場合は、エミュレータで実行中のコードにこのポートを使用するように指示する必要があります。 8081で実行中のサービスは削除できませんか? – Eldelshell

+0

はい、あなたはそれについて正しいと思います。私は、コード内のどこにあるポート番号を変更する必要があることを読んでいました。私はそのポートで実行中のプロセスを削除できませんでした。私はそのポートでOracleを実行しています。私はコードでポート番号を変更しようとするか、そのポートで動作しているOracleリスナーを停止しようとします。ありがとう。 – Faisal

関連する問題